Gillard wins election on Facebook

Announcement posted by DesignCrowd.com 23 Aug 2010

Julia Gillard has beaten Tony Abbott and Hamish & Andy in online poll (on Facebook) to select Australia's next PM
Australian based crowdsourcing site DesignCrowd has announced Julia Gillard as the winner of their Unofficial Australian Election on Facebook.

Gillard received 25.8% of total votes followed closely by Hamish & Andy from 2DayFM with 19.7% of votes and Tony Abbott with 15.2% of votes. Kevin Rudd tied with Batman on 6.1% of votes while Jeff (from The Wiggles) and Sam Newman both received 4.5% of votes. Kyle Sandilands, Mark Philippoussis and The Fully Sick Rapper also received nominations and votes.


FacebookElection.png

The online election, launched last week, was designed to explore alternative Prime Ministers to Abbott and Gillard as well as stimulate public discussion and interest in how 'crowdsourcing' and technology might help improve our system for electing governments and operating governments.
